Anissaras beach
The holiday resort of Anissaras is situated in northeastern Crete, around 25 km east of the island’s capital, Heraklion, and 2–3 km northwest of the larger resort of Hersonissos.
Anissaras beach
Anissaras beach is almost 1 km long, although most of it is only 10–20 metres wide. It is mainly covered in pale sand, mixed with some shingle in places. The water is exceptionally clear but becomes deep fairly quickly.

There are plenty of sections where sun loungers and parasols can be hired, and showers are also available. There is usually plenty of space on the beach.
Behind the beach are several large and attractive family hotels. Child friendliness
The sand is ideal for playing, including along the water’s edge. However, the water deepens fairly quickly.

Water sports
Visitors can hire jet skis, windsurfing equipment, sea kayaks, small catamarans and pedalos.
Restaurants near the beach
There are a handful of restaurants behind the beach, although most dining options are found within the hotels.

Anissaras holiday resort
Anissaras is mainly a spread-out resort area with many newer, family-friendly hotels. There is no real high street or town centre, but restaurants, mini-markets and tourist shops are dotted throughout the area.
A couple of kilometres to the west is the pleasant little village of Analipsi, while Hersonissos lies a few kilometres to the south. Hersonissos has a much wider selection of shops and restaurants.
Southwest of Anissaras is Watercity Waterpark, the largest water park in Crete. It offers plenty of fun for the whole family, and the journey of around 16 km is easily made by taxi or hire car.
